Problems solved by technology

[0004] Usually, street lamps equipped with electronic ballasts are often started and stopped during use, which may easily cause the power electronic components of electronic ballasts to be affected by transient high voltage during startup. Therefore, in 80% of cases, electronic ballasts are damaged. All of them are power electronic components; at present, the direct replacement method is adopted for the faulty electronic ballasts, and in order to keep the technology confidential, the ballast manufacturers adopt an integrated design for the ballasts, The components in the device are plastic-sealed together, so that the replaced ballast cannot be repaired. This method of directly replacing the ballast not only makes the maintenance cost high, but also brings waste of resources, which violates the national energy conservation policy. policy

Abstract

Disclosed is separation-type electronic ballast for a high-voltage sodium lamp. The electronic ballast comprises an electronic ballast PCB (printed circuit board), a radiating shell and electronic power elements separated from the electronic ballast PCB, the separate electronic power elements are mounted on the radiating shell, the electronic ballast PCB is connected with the separate electronic power elements, the separate electronic power elements can be directly replaced when an electronic power element module is damaged, and replacement of the integral electronic ballast is omitted. The separation-type electronic ballast with the structure has the advantages that the maintenance cost of the electronic ballast for the high-voltage sodium lamp is greatly lowered, energy consumption is reduced, and work efficiency is improved.

Description

technical field [0001] The invention relates to an energy-saving high-pressure sodium lamp integrated and separated electronic ballast. The core power electronic components in the ballast are separated from the PCB board (printed circuit board) of the electronic ballast to facilitate maintenance of the ballast. Background technique [0002] Electronic ballasts are converters that convert industrial-frequency AC power into high-frequency AC power. They mainly go through two different stages: inductive and digital. [0003] Digital electronic ballasts are aimed at analog electronic ballasts.
